Who won Cullen vs Yildirim?
Jack Cullen beat Avni Yildirim by unanimous decision in their 10 round contest on Saturday 31st July 2021 at Matchroom Fight Camp in Essex.
The scorecards were announced as 92-98, 90-100, 93-97 in favor of winner Jack Cullen.
The fight was scheduled to take place over 10 rounds in the Super Middleweight division, which meant the weight limit was 168 pounds (12 stone or 76.2 KG).
This fight appeared on the undercard of Can Xu losing to Leigh Wood for the WBA World Featherweight championship. Also, on the undercard Anthony Fowler beat Rico Mueller and Tommy McCarthy was overcome by Chris Billam-Smith for the CBC Commonwealth Cruiserweight and BBBOC British Cruiserweight titles.
Cullen vs Yildirim stats
Avni Yildirim stepped into the ring with a record of 21 wins, 3 loses and 0 draws, 12 of those wins coming by the way of knock out.
Jack Cullen made his way to the ring with a record of 19 wins, 2 loses and 1 draw, with 9 of those wins by knock out.
The stats suggested Yildirim had a slight advantage in power over Cullen, with a 57% knock out percentage over Cullen's 47%.
Avni Yildirim was the older man by 2 years, at 31 years old.
Cullen had a height advantage of 4 inches over Yildirim.
Both Avni Yildirim & Jack Cullen fought out of an orthodox stance.
Yildirim was the more experienced professional fighter, having had 2 more fights, and made his debut in 2014, 2 years and 7 months earlier than Cullen, whose first professional fight was in 2016. He had fought 12 more professional rounds, 145 to Cullen's 133.
Cullen vs Yildirim form
Yildirim had won 5 of his most recent fights, stopping 3 of them, going the distance twice.
In his last fight before this contest, he had beat Marco Antonio Periban on 13th May 2017 by unanimous decision in their 12 round contest at Teatro Palcco, Jalisco, Mexico.
Previous to that, he had beat Aliaksandr Sushchyts on 18th February 2017 by knockout in the 1st round at Teatro Principe, Milan, Italy.
Going into that contest, he had won against Schiller Hyppolite on 5th November 2016 by technical knockout in the 3rd round at Ballhaus Forum, Munich, Germany.
Before that, he had beat Aaron Pryor Jr on 27th August 2016 by unanimous decision in their 10 round contest at Huxleys, Kreuzberg.
He had defeated Timur Nikarkhoev on 23rd July 2016 by technical knockout in the 5th round at Iron gym- Forckenberckstr 9-13, Schmargendorf.
Activity check
Yildirim's last 5 fights had come over a period of 6 years, 10 months and 14 days, meaning he had been fighting on average every 1 year, 4 months and 16 days. In those fights, he fought a total of 31 rounds, meaning that they had lasted 6.2 rounds on average.
Cullen's last 3 fights had come over a period of 3 years, 2 months and 30 days, meaning he had been fighting on average every 1 year and 30 days. In those fights, he fought a total of 22 rounds, meaning that they had lasted 7.3 rounds on average.
